Hamilton denies being disappointed with second in Melbourne

© XPB  Andrew Lewin 17/03/2019 at 08:19 Lewis Hamilton is the acknowledged master of Melbourne in qualifying, but when it comes to the race itself it seems that victory just keeps slipping through the five-time world champion's fingers. Last year Hamilton was pipped to the win by Ferrari's Sebastian Vettel. This time it was his own Mercedes team mate Valtteri Bottas who got the jump on him at the start and disappeared into the distance. Hamilton successfully fended off Red Bull's Max Verstappen to keep hold of second place to the finish, and said he was "not disappointed" after missing out on the top step on the podium yet again.
